Madison Youth Football and Cheer announces registration dates

Staff Reports 

MADISON — Madison Youth Football and Cheer, a non-profit, all volunteer and youth recreational football and cheer league, announced its registration dates for 2013.

The last two remaining days to register are on June 13 and June 27 from 4:30 p.m.  to 8 p.m. at the Dublin Park Recreational Center.

This year’s football teams include the Tiny Mites (ages 7 and under), Mighty Mites (ages 9 and under), Junior Pee Wee (ages 10 and under) and Pee Wee (ages 11 and under).

Registration is available online as well at www.madisonyfc.org. Madison Youth Football and Cheer is headed up by Mike Murrah and is sponsored by Dick’s Sporting Goods.

“The sole purpose of Madison YFC is to provide the local community with organized, adult-supervised, healthy football and cheerleading programs consistent with North Alabama American Youth Football, Inc. (NAAYF) and American Youth Football rules,” the organization’s mission statement read. “In doing so, this organization will constantly promote the ideas of fellowship, community spirit, good sportsmanship and fair play while ensuring that proper training, instruction, safety and equipment are furnished to the participants.”
